Serenity Hill, atop Sunrise Beach's northern cliff, is more serene and relaxed than the bustling beach side resorts, but it also has a couple of happening bars nearby. The Mellow Mountain Bar and its own Freedom Bar attract crowds throughout the afternoon and evening with DJs at Freedom many nights. Lots of stairs lead to the wooden bungalows with stone bathrooms. These look worn outside but are solid and clean inside with soft beds and fresh bathrooms. Depending on the position, these bungalows have lovely views either out to sea or overlooking the bay and beach, and small decks with hammocks are a good place from which to enjoy the breeze away from most of the madness below.

* Travelfish researchers visit and review properties on an anonymous basis. By that we mean they show up, in person, and pretend to be either be a potential guest, or somebody looking for a room for a friend or relative. Where possible the researcher will inspect at least a couple of rooms. The rates you see above are what either the desk staff told us they were, or what were in the brochure when they just told us to quit bugging them and look in the brochure. A great spot on Haad Rin and far enough away from the crazy end of the beach to allow a good night's sleep. The bungalows are all out on the rocks, so it's a short stroll down to the beach. At night they light up the restaurant and it looks like a Christmas tree - kind of cool as we'd never stayed in a Christmas tree before.
